Healthy Cranberry Oatmeal Muffins
These Healthy Cranberry Oatmeal Muffins are a morning treat I feel good about. They are nutritious and delicious breakfast option that will satisfy your sweet tooth without sugar! Best recipe for a busy morning or make-ahead breakfast.

Ingredients
1 ½
c.
190 g rolled oats
3
tbsp.
25 g stevia
¼
c.
40 g dried cranberries
1
tsp.
baking powder
½
c.
80 g unsweetened applesauce
1
large egg
1/2
c.
125 ml milk, 2%
1
tsp.
vanilla extract
Instructions
Preheat the oven to 375°F.
Spray a muffin tin with non-stick spray or line with muffin pan liners.
In a mixing bowl combine the oats, stevia, cranberries, and baking powder.
In another bowl combine the applesauce, eggs, milk, and vanilla; blend well.
Add the wet ingredients to the dry ingredients, mixing gently until just combined.
With a scoop or spoon fill each muffin tin 3/4 of the way.
Bake for about 25 -30 minutes or until tops are golden.
Serve and enjoy!

How Many Calories in Healthy Cranberry Oatmeal Muffins
Calories (per 100 g /1 serve): 247 cal
Fat: 5.1 g
Carbohydrates: 45.5 g
Protein: 8.6 g
